Skip to content
Snippets Groups Projects
  1. Jun 21, 2024
    • Alexander Purr's avatar
      refs #26301 [fid_adlr] · 0a2e3e69
      Alexander Purr authored and Mathias Maaß's avatar Mathias Maaß committed
      * add missing record type decider on formatter spec
      ** since usage of solrcloud SolrIS (extends SolrAI) is used automatically instead of SolrAI
      * make AI used traits available for (temporarily used?) SolrIS
      ** add adrl/SolrIS Driver inherits from finc/SolrIS
      2 tags
      0a2e3e69
  2. Jun 19, 2024
  3. May 24, 2024
  4. May 03, 2024
  5. Apr 29, 2024
  6. Apr 10, 2024
  7. Apr 09, 2024
  8. Apr 05, 2024
    • Robert Lange's avatar
      refs #25800 [fid] · 83a4c3c1
      Robert Lange authored and Mathias Maaß's avatar Mathias Maaß committed
      * refactor rss client
      * set keepalive for connection to true
      * use only one parameter for feed url instead of two
      83a4c3c1
  9. Mar 15, 2024
    • Robert Lange's avatar
      refs #25348 [fid] fid client rework · 7f600280
      Robert Lange authored and Mathias Maaß's avatar Mathias Maaß committed
      * do not proxify local_addresses
      * use Laminas http client in fid client
      * do not use vufindhttp-psrcompat and zend-psr18bridge
      * simplify: remove sendAuthenticatedRequest and buildRequest => senRequest
      * refresh logon after 401 (when stale?)
      * add comment and set headers always by key => value
      * deactivate SSL_VERIFY for fidis request
      * fix options for ssl
      * do not retry refreshLogon
      7f600280
  10. Feb 29, 2024
    • Alexander Purr's avatar
      refs #25606 [fid_adlr] reuse RSS-reader-helper of fid · 1de5b0fd
      Alexander Purr authored
      * is in fid_bbi in use too
      * remove RSS-reader-helper implementation of fid_adlr and listing in module.config.php
      * adjust configuration
      * shrink usage in home.phtml
      * load rss-feed from now on directly from adlr-link-blog instead of the RSS-File-Copy within catalog
      * add Blog-Config-section: do not use RssConsumer['fallback_url'] url as blog url any more
      1de5b0fd
  11. Feb 19, 2024
  12. Jan 30, 2024
    • Alexander Purr's avatar
      refs #24868 [fid_adlr] inter library loan link · e5f5693c
      Alexander Purr authored and Mathias Maaß's avatar Mathias Maaß committed
      * reuse trait in drivers
      * add rules to get-it-rules-file
      ** show if record in certain IDs & user is logged in & library network in germany
      * add template
      ** show link and hint to library network
      * add ids to each order button (for easier identification on selenium tests)
      e5f5693c
  13. Jan 24, 2024
  14. Jan 18, 2024
    • Alexander Purr's avatar
      refs #24734 [fid_adr] vf7 design adjustments · 1acbcccf
      Alexander Purr authored and Mathias Maaß's avatar Mathias Maaß committed
      * remove borders in category-widget (on activated search-tab) in "associated volumes"-tab
      * repositioning get-it-box
      * set correct names of record-data-formatter-specs in view helper (falsely introduced with vf7 template reconciliation)
      * get-it-box: buttons and resource-widget with same width (always 100%)
      * result-list headings
      ** adjust styling
      ** use origin design line-height ~1.5
      ** align access-icon and heading
      * details view: adjust margin & line-height of heading
      * increase result-list item padding (see design prototype)
      * XS: display media icon container on top of record
      * add debug bar snippet to footer.phtml
      * lightbox: show close-button on SM / tablet completely (half hidden before)
      * lightbox: show close-button on SM / tablet completely (half hidden before)
      * error 2
      ** record details: adjust letter spacing of title
      * error 3
      ** record list item: adjust letter spacing in title
      * error 7
      ** advances search sidebar: items like in design template
      * remove falsely added screen-size-debug-bar
      * home page: change link order after search box
      * home page styling
      ** increase width of main title on xl by removing left-padding
      ** improve vertical alignment of links following the search box
      * result-list: remove scss (formerly corresponding to header-tag, now usage of h2 in result-item)
      * better comments
      1acbcccf
  15. Jan 11, 2024
  16. Jan 04, 2024
  17. Dec 20, 2023
  18. Dec 08, 2023
    • Alexander Purr's avatar
      refs #24836 [fid_adr] w3c · 2c5013f5
      Alexander Purr authored and Mathias Maaß's avatar Mathias Maaß committed
      * error: Error: Duplicate ID toolbar-menu
      ** removed and icon title added
      *  Error: Attribute href not allowed on element button at this point.
      ** change button to a
      * Error: Element div not allowed as child of element h2 in this context. (Suppressing further errors from this subtree.)
      ** remove nesting; move margin-btm class into a; add display-block style
      * add missing ids on inputs
      * correct heading translation
      * ship correct aria-describedby for subrecord favorite-action
      * error: doubled head-title
      ** use solution from 18780
      2c5013f5
  19. Dec 07, 2023
  20. Dec 06, 2023
  21. Nov 30, 2023
  22. Nov 07, 2023
  23. Oct 17, 2023
  24. Oct 12, 2023
    • Alexander Purr's avatar
      refs #24326 [fid_adlr] template reconciliation vf6->vf7 · 1909842c
      Alexander Purr authored and Mathias Maaß's avatar Mathias Maaß committed
      * cart/*
      * feedback/*
      * remove HelpTranslations/*
      * layout/layout.phtml
      * search/*
      ** moving partial from results.phtml into controls/results-tools.phtml
      ** rename advanced_search_information.phtml into advanced-search-information.phtml
      * footer.phtml (no changes - to specific)
      * header.phtml (no changes - to specific)
      * fid/*
      * myresearch/*
      * Recomment/*
      * record/*
      * RecordDriver/*/core.phtml
      ** Resolve name of RecordDataFormatter specification by record type (using added record-view-helper function)
      ** move tab-rendering in two separate templates
      * RecordDriver/*
      * additional: scss reordering
      ** move font- & icon-variables into _customVariables.scss
      ** move import of icon-components in _customComponents.scss
      1909842c
  25. Oct 09, 2023
  26. Sep 28, 2023
  27. Sep 27, 2023
    • Robert Lange's avatar
      refs #24163 [finc] basic performance adaptions · 521200d4
      Robert Lange authored
      * expand selenium tests
      ** fix selenium test for ubl changeLanguage
      ** add test for performance on result list
      ** example: docker exec -it selenium_php_1 sh -c "./vendor/bin/steward run de_15/24163 firefox --group performance-static --server-url http://selenium:4444/wd/hub -vvv"
      ** remove unused and large chrome image
      
      * add finc performance logger for simple time measurement as csv format
      * add http debug service for unlogged requests
      * need to be uncommented in module.config (also set file name under [Logging])
      
      * Docker
      ** use image labels to avoid multiple images, container (and build caches) for each instance
      ** activate OpCache for PHP 8 to increase dev performance
  28. Sep 26, 2023
  29. Sep 07, 2023
  30. Aug 31, 2023
    • Robert Lange's avatar
      refs #24324 [fid_adlr] vf7 upgrade · 6939dbd0
      Robert Lange authored
      * recaptcha => captcha
      * comment out duplicate QueryFields
      * Zend => Laminas
      * fix code style: include instead of require
      * add csp ini
      * update dbis-module to 5.0.0
      * update boss-module to 3.0.0
      * update dbis-module to 5.0.0
      * update worldcat module to 1.1
      
      co-authored by: Alexander Purr <purr@ub.uni-leipzig.de>
      * use renamed cookies js file
      * replace Zend by Laminas in templates
      * feedback forms
      * FeedbackForms.yaml:
      ** prevent >>The reserved indicator % cannot start a plain scalar; you need to quote the scalar<<
      ** update docs
      * load correct capcha-view-helper
      * complement user-table-list for admin
      * reconfigure order list columns in user profile
      * using inline-script view-helper
      * add missing function in facets.ini that causes error
      6939dbd0
  31. Aug 30, 2023
    • Jean-Pascal Kanter's avatar
      refs #24360 [fid] w3c · a27fde52
      Jean-Pascal Kanter authored
      * the better solution for missing ids in form fields:
      * add Ids for admin-edit-form.php
      * set correct attribute name in password-change-form.php
      * remove autocomplete on radio button in user-create-form.php
      * add correct php tag
      * remove duplicate ID in create.phtml
      a27fde52
  32. Aug 16, 2023
  33. Aug 15, 2023